[Female mate choice, male-male competition, and male sexual traits: Experimental study of sexual selection directedness in Campbell's dwarf hamster (Phodopus campbelli Thomas 1905)]

Vasilieva Ny, O. N. Shekarova, Khrushchova Am, K. Rogovin

2017.3.1ZHURNAL OBSHCHEI BIOLOGII

tlooto Summary

It is found that female mate choice was not dependent on male aggressive and sexual dominance estimated through encounter experiments, and there are no reasons to discuss the expression of ST in Campbell dwarf hamster males in terms of intersexual or intrasexual selection mechanisms or in their interaction.
